The brand is now launching a new Renewal Collection that works in harmony with the skin’s 28-day natural renewal cycle. Formulated with a new Apple and Hibiscus Rejuvenating Complex and packed with botanicals, the Renewal line aims to fight the signs of aging
and reveal more youthful, healthy-looking skin.
